lo 5.1-5.3. what are the biceps responsible for?
straightening the elbow
extending the elbow
bending the elbow
stabilizing the shoulder joint
adducting the shoulder

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

The biceps muscle is a flexor of the elbow joint. It contracts to bend the elbow, bringing the forearm closer to the upper - arm. Straightening and extending the elbow are functions of extensor muscles. Stabilizing the shoulder joint and adducting the shoulder are not the primary functions of the biceps.

Answer:

C. Bending the elbow
